Saudi Arabia Arrested 149 Al-Qaeda Militants In Past Eight Months


Saudi Arabia says it has arrested 149 people from 19 cells linked to Al-Qaeda over the past eight months, and foiled attacks against government and security officials as well as journalists.

The Interior Ministry said that out of the 149, 124 were Saudis while the rest belonged to other nationalities.

In March, the kingdom arrested more than 100 militants who had been planning attacks on energy facilities in the world's top oil exporter.

They were reportedly backed by the Yemen-based Al-Qaeda in the Arabian Peninsula.
